Approaching the Fann Mountains

Next, you’ll have an hour to appreciate the spectacular Fann Mountains. As you approach Iskanderkul, you’ll see the dramatic peaks like Bodhona, Chapdara, and the towering Chimtarga (5,487 meters). One traveler shared, “The area feels like stepping into a mountain painting with the peaks reaching for the sky,” making this a photographer’s paradise.

The Highlight: Iskanderkul Lake

Arriving around 1 PM, you’ll have about an hour to explore the lake area. The lake’s triangular shape, 3.5 square km of surface area, and 70-meter depth make it a stunning sight. The water’s clarity and mountain backdrop are picture-perfect, especially at midday when the sun highlights the shimmering surface.

Reviewers emphasize that the lake’s location at over 2000 meters altitude makes it cooler and fresher than lower altitudes, perfect for a break from summer heat. You can opt to swim, rent a boat, or simply relax on the shore, soaking in the panoramic vistas. The lake is surprisingly large, with a coastline stretching out for about 14 km, giving plenty of space for leisure.

Legends and Waterfalls: Enriching the Experience

Following lakeside relaxation, the tour visits Panj-Chashma Springs and Busefal Canyon. Legend has it that Bucephalus, Alexander the Great’s famous horse, drank from the lake and fell ill, leading to a mythic tale about the white horse that emerges during full moons. According to one review, “The legend adds a mystical touch to the serene landscape, making the visit even more memorable.”

The Fan Niagara, a 43-meter waterfall, offers a spectacular hike and photo opportunity. Reviewers mention that the hike is manageable but adds a sense of adventure. Nearby, Snake Lake is warmer and home to non-aggressive snakes, making it an intriguing spot for a quick dip or exploration.

Mountain Hike to Moron Lake and Iskanderkul Waterfall

Post-lunch, a hike to Moron Lake and the waterfall offers a closer look at the mountain environment. The waterfall, called “Fan Niagara,” has historical inscriptions dating back to 1870, adding a layer of historical intrigue. Travelers report feeling refreshed and energized after the short trek amid stunning mountain scenery.
